Description

Sit around the campfire eating your beans, drinking coffee and slicing up your beef jerky with your Rough Rider Cowboy knife!

This is a fun little knife with a brass handle featuring scenes of cowboys at work. The 440 stainless steel blade is non-locking and under three inches long making it a UK friendly carry knife.
